The red wine Languedoc AOC Les Eclats, vintage 2016 from the winery Mas d'Auzières has been rated in 2020 by Ulrich Sautter with 89 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ape varieties Grenache, Mourvèdre, Syrah from the region Languedoc-Roussillon in France.

Tasting Notes

89
Tasting from 18.02.2020: Ulrich Sautter

Herbal scent, with slightly buttery tones and cocktail cherry, light-bodied, juicy in the mouth, ripe tannins in restrained quantities, an uncomplicated, harmonious representative of its region of provenance.
